The Met Police said it has received “a number of allegations of sexual offences" in the wake of reports produced by Channel 4's Dispatches and The Sunday Times about Russell Brand.
The comedian and actor has strongly denied accusations made by four women in the joint investigation. On Monday, the force said it has since received a “number of allegations of sexual offences in London” as well as elsewhere in the country. In a short statement, police said all allegations were non-recent and there have been no arrests made.
